Quick Reference Table: Standard Tank Sizes
To provide aquarists a quick baseline, the table below describes standard tank dimensions together with their optimum theoretical capacities and estimated net volumes (accounting for substrate and hardscape).
Tank Type/ SizeDimensions (L x W x H in inches)Max Capacity (Gallons)Estimated Net Volume (Gallons)Standard 10 Gallon20" x 10" x 12"10.48.5-- 9Standard 20 Gallon Long30" x 12" x 12"18.716-- 17Requirement 29 Gallon30" x 12" x 18"28.124-- 25Standard 40 Gallon Breeder36" x 18" x 16"44.938-- 40Standard 55 Gallon48" x 13" x 21"58.148-- 50Standard 75 Gallon48" x 18" x 21"80.568-- 72Requirement 90 Gallon48" x 18" x 24"92.078-- 82Standard 125 Gallon72" x 18" x 22"124.6105-- 115
Keep in mind: Calculations utilize interior measurements where possible, however real glass density and cut can modify the last numbers a little.
